Induction hobs
Induction hobs are a hit due to their sleek flat surfaces that are simpler to clean than gas hobs. They are energy-efficient and offer precise temperature control. This makes them ideal for delicate sauces and searing meats. They also cool quickly, which means you won't burn your fingers when you touch the surface. You'll need a compatible set of cookware to make use of these. They are not suitable for people who have pacemakers because the electromagnetic field created by induction could interfere with.
Induction hobs typically come with indicators that display the power levels and settings. This gives your kitchen a futuristic look. Some models also have integrated bridge zones that let you combine cooking areas to accommodate larger pans which makes them a great option for roasting and griddles pans. Some models have a boost feature that temporarily increases the power output of a zone. This allows you to quickly bring the water to a boil or sear your meat.
A residual heat indicator is another useful feature. It shows that the stove is hot even after it has been turned off. This feature can prevent accidental burns in homes with young children. Some cooktops are also equipped with child locks to ensure your children are secure while you cook.

Gas hobs
Gas hobs are a staple of UK kitchens, due to their ability to provide instant heating and precise temperature control. They also have an elegant and professional appearance which can be integrated into a variety of kitchen designs. In addition, most modern gas hobs feature automatic ignition. This means that the moment you turn on the stove, it triggers an electric spark that ignites the gas in the burner. This is safer than older types of gas hobs that required lighters or matchboxes. Gas hobs come with a visual flame indicator that allows you to know if the flame is lit. This can help prevent gas leaks and accidental burns.
There are many different choices for gas hobs, ranging from simple single-burner designs to large powered wok burners. Some models come with dual flame burners that allow users to alter the size of the flame and precisely regulate the heat. Other features include the vortex flame, which eliminates the loss of heat from the sides of the burner and a sleek, toughened glass surface that is easy to clean.

Hobs made of solid-plate
Providing a simple yet reliable cooking solution Solid plate hobs have served as the stalwart of many homes for many years. Electricity is used to heat flat metal plates, making this an affordable option that is easy to use and maintain. Their basic design makes them less energy efficient than other hobs, leading to higher electric bills. They also take longer to cool and heat than other hobs. This can be a problem for those who are used to cooking faster.
Solid plate hobs are an excellent choice for those on a tight budget. They offer even heating and are compatible with all types of pots. They also have simple dial controls for convenient temperature adjustment. In addition, they usually have indicators that let you know the time a plate is hot or switched on, increasing safety.
The solid plate design is vulnerable to electrical short-circuits, and could need more maintenance than other hobs. They also don't offer as much flexibility as other hobs like ceramic or induction hobs, and can be difficult to clean because of their exposed metal plates.

Ceramic hobs
Ceramic hobs are elegant and fashionable. They are a popular choice for modern kitchens. Their flat surface makes them easy to clean, and they also tend to be less expensive than other hobs. They are also energy efficient since the heating elements only heat the hob surface not the pans that sit that sit on top.
As with induction hobs and ceramic hobs have many features to help you cook more efficiently and more practical. For instance, some models have a 'FlexiDuo' function which lets you combine two cooking zones into one space to accommodate larger pans. These models also come with residual temperature indicators as well as child locks in order to ensure your children's safety.
The major difference between an induction and ceramic hob is that a ceramic hob does not make use of magnetic fields to heat the pans. Instead, they utilize heating elements that are electric beneath each cooking zone. This means they may take a bit longer heat up and cool down than induction hobs. However, they still have a great track record in terms of energy efficiency.
Despite being more expensive than gas or solid plate hobs they have many advantages that justify the extra cost. For example, they're very easy to clean and do not have open flames, which means that you're less likely to burn yourself accidentally. They're also more efficient than gas hobs and are more environmentally friendly, as they don't use as much energy over the course of time.
